How On Earth Did I Get A Yeast Infection For Men?
The number one cause of a yeast infection for men is by catching it from a woman you’re having sex with.
But there are tons of other ways you could get one.

Other causes of yeast infections include:
- Having a weak immune system due to HIV, under active thyroid gland, chronic stress or a slew of other disorders.
- Taking antibiotics, which wipe out the good bacteria in the penis and crotch, which would normally keep an overgrowth of yeast at bay.
- Diabetes. This raises sugar levels in the urine, which which makes for an awesome “yeast breeding” environment
- Exposure to Nonoxynol-9. This is a chemical found in a wide variety of detergents, cosmetics, lubricants in condoms and in contraceptives. It was once thought to protect against STDs including HIV, but studies have shown that it damages the physical barriers of the rectum and vagina, leading to infections.
- A diet that’s too yeast friendly Lot’s of men don’t realize that they’re eating foods that are practically inviting a yeast infection. These foods include starchy simple carbohydrates, and foods that are particularly yeasty, like lots of bread and beer.

Where Can You Get A Yeast Infection For Men?
Some common places for yeast infections in men are:
- The penis
- The tongue (an oral yeast infectionin a man can also be picked up from oral sex with an infected woman)
- Between the toes
- In the anus
Other less common places include the underarms, around the mouth, and in various body folds.
